At The Fund for Santa Barbara, our mission is to advance progressive change by strengthening movements for Economic, Environmental, Political, Racial, and Social Justice. To achieve this mission, we need your help. Unlike other foundations, we raise our own money to support our annual budget, which means our work is largely made possible by individual donors committed to bolstering progressive change across the Central Coast. Last year, we counted on more than 500 individual donors, and today – we are asking you to build on that number by signing on to our monthly giving program. Imagine what we can do together. 

When you sign-up for monthly giving, you are enabling us to expand on our ability to build the capacity of organizations at the forefront of addressing inequity in Santa Barbara County. Whether enough to help offset sliding scale workshop fees, or enough to cover a small grant, every contribution, no matter the amount, makes a difference.
